2016 - 2024

感恩一路有你

python items python seek函数以及用法?

浏览量:2701 时间:2021-03-11 20:04:44 作者:admin

python seek函数以及用法?

方法用于将文件读取指针移动到指定位置。

文件对象.seek(offset[,when])

offset—起始偏移量,即需要移动的字节数

when:可选。默认值为0。为offset参数指定一个定义,该定义指示要从哪个位置进行偏移;0表示从文件开头开始,1表示从当前位置开始,2表示从文件结尾开始。

python中file.seek( ) 的用法?

seek函数不返回值,您的打印将以无显示文件.seek(0)被重新定位到文件的第0位和起始位置

file=open()测试.txt“,”RW“;注意这行的变化文件.seek(3) #转到第三个

对于文件中的I:

打印我

#现在是最后一个

对于文件中的我:

打印我

#不会显示任何结果文件.seek(0)#定位到0

对于文件中的I:

打印I

;[添加

重新定位到0的好处是您不必再次打开文件。

文件.seek(3)

文件.write(“insert”)在代码的open部分,我将模式改为读写

您可以使用文件指针的seek()方法,该方法设置文件的当前位置偏移量。它有两个参数:偏移量:文件读写指针的位置偏移量。当:这是可选的。默认值为0,表示绝对文件位置。值为1表示相对于当前位置。值为2表示相对于文件结尾。fp=打开(“meelo.txt文件)数据=fp.read读取()读取文件内容后,指针指向文件结尾fp.seek查找(0)#指针返回到文件的开头

这不需要执行计划任务。只需使用tail-f文件名| grep执行太慢。然后WC计算行数。如果你必须用Python来做的话。使用file对象中的seek方法移动到最后一个处理位置。

python中回到文件的开头?

你的意思是二进制读取?有权访问numpy.fromfile文件(),您也可以使用open(文件名,“RB”),其中“B”表示二进制,然后使用文件类型的read方法读取一些字节,然后使用结构解包()方法来解析二进制文件。第一种方法是一次将文件(或文件的前几个连续字节)读入一个数组,因此灵活性较差。第二种方法非常灵活。它可以在任何位置读取二进制数据(使用文件的seek()方法跳过该位置),然后使用它结构解包()各种二进制解析的方法。提示:二进制文件是一种不保持存储模式的数据格式。因此,在读取二进制文件时,应该了解二进制文件的存储格式。

python分析系统日志?

Python open()方法用于打开文件并返回文件对象。在处理文件的过程中需要此函数。如果文件无法打开,将抛出oserror。

注意:使用open()方法时,请确保关闭file对象,即调用close()方法。

open()函数的常见形式是接收两个参数:文件名和模式。

打开(文件,模式=“r”)

python items python中seek的参数 python实例

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。